Which Hotels James Bond Lived In

The Peninsula, Hong Kong, China

In The Man with the Golden Gun (1974), Bond’s girlfriend Andrea Anders (Maude Adams) is taken for a ride in the Rolls-Royce provided by the hotel. The iconic facade of this luxury hotel appears in several scenes. The film crew also spent a night at this hotel near Victoria Bay, Hong Kong.

Taj Lake Palace, Udaipur, India

In 1983 this hotel was the home of Octopussy (Maude Adams) in the movie of the same name. The white marble Taj Lake Palace was built in 1746 and is located on Lake Pichola in Udaipur, India. The hotel is completely surrounded by the water and for once in your life you should stay here to feel like a maharaja.
